Technical Breakdown: How Live Scores Are Delivered
The process of delivering live scores and updates involves sophisticated technology and infrastructure. Here’s a step-by-step look at how it works:
1. Data Collection
Specialized data collectors and statisticians are stationed at stadiums to gather information on the game's progress, including goals, fouls, and player substitutions.
2. Data Transmission
The collected data is transmitted in real-time to central servers, often through secure, high-speed connections.
3. Processing and Analysis
Advanced algorithms process the incoming data, analyzing it to provide accurate and timely updates.
4. Distribution
The processed information is then distributed across various platforms, including websites, mobile apps, and social media channels.

Challenges in Broadcasting Live Football
While technology has made it easier to broadcast live football matches to a global audience, several challenges remain. These include:
Challenges:
- Copyright and Broadcasting Rights: The cost and complexity of acquiring broadcasting rights can be a significant barrier.
- Technical Issues: Ensuring a stable and high-quality broadcast is crucial, as technical glitches can detract from the viewing experience.
- Piracy: Unauthorized streaming of live matches remains a persistent issue, affecting revenue streams for legitimate broadcasters.
Opportunities:
- Innovative Streaming Solutions: Advances in streaming technology offer new ways to deliver high-quality live football to fans.
- Global Reach: The ability to broadcast matches globally opens up new markets and revenue streams.
- Enhanced Fan Experience: Technology can be used to provide fans with a more immersive experience, including real-time statistics and interactive features.
